What I Check Before Buying
Before I place an order, I always confirm the cartridge model number. The HP Envy Photo 7855 typically uses HP 64 or HP 64XL cartridges, depending on whether I want standard or high-yield printing. I also check whether I need black ink, tri-color ink, or both, since my printing habits affect which one I should buy first.
Standard vs. XL Cartridges
I usually compare standard and XL cartridges carefully. Standard cartridges cost less upfront, but I find that XL cartridges often give me better value if I print often. If I only print occasionally, standard cartridges may be enough. If I print photos, schoolwork, or documents regularly, I prefer XL because I don’t have to replace them as often.
Original vs. Compatible Cartridges
I’ve found that original HP cartridges usually give me the most reliable results, especially for photos and important documents. Compatible cartridges can be more affordable, but I make sure the seller has good reviews and clear return policies before trying them. For me, reliability is worth paying a little extra when I need sharp, consistent prints.

How I Save Money
I try to save money by buying multipacks when I know I’ll need both black and color ink. I also compare prices from different sellers and watch for discounts on XL cartridges. Another thing that helps me is checking ink subscription programs, since they can lower my cost if I print regularly.
Things I Avoid
I avoid buying cartridges without checking the exact printer model. I also stay away from listings that don’t clearly mention HP Envy Photo 7855 compatibility. If a deal looks too good to be true, I pause and read reviews first, because I don’t want to risk poor print quality or cartridges that don’t work.
